A powerful tornado struck the town of Pomas in southern France on Monday, injuring dozens of people and damaging hundreds of homes [1, 2].

The disaster highlights the increasing volatility of severe weather patterns in the Aude department, where the rapid onset of the storm left residents with little time to seek shelter.

Emergency services reported that between 39 [2, 3, 4, 5] and 41 [6] people were injured during the event. Of those injured, 17 were hospitalized [1] and two remain in critical condition [1]. The tornado reportedly reached wind speeds of 400 km/h [7] as it tore through the region.

Officials estimate that approximately 300 houses were damaged or destroyed [2, 7, 8]. The destruction was widespread, affecting a significant portion of the local community. Emmanuelle Plantier‑Lemarchand, the sub-prefect of Carcassonne, said practically more than two-thirds of the commune suffered the impact of the storm [1].

The storm caused immediate infrastructure failure, resulting in power outages for thousands of households [2]. Authorities coordinated the evacuation of thousands of people to ensure public safety as recovery efforts began [3].

Pomas is located about 10 km north-east of Carcassonne [1, 2]. The tornado swept through the town in a matter of minutes, leaving a trail of debris across the residential areas [1, 8].

Local crews continue to clear roads and assess the structural integrity of remaining buildings. The French government has not yet released a formal total on the economic losses associated with the property damage.
